Intel to invest $5.7 billion(約9100億円) in Ireland for AI capacity

Top Companies AI — US (1/2)4h ago

Key takeaway

Intel announced a $5.7 billion(約9100億円) capital investment in Ireland centered on AI capability development. The move reflects Intel's effort to expand its AI manufacturing footprint and compete in the rapidly growing global AI chip market.

Context & Analysis

Intel's $5.7 billion(約9100億円) investment in Ireland represents a strategic move to build AI manufacturing capacity in Europe. By anchoring investment in Ireland, Intel is diversifying its production base beyond the United States, potentially reducing supply chain risk and positioning itself closer to European markets and customers. The AI-focused nature of the investment reflects the semiconductor industry's shift toward supporting artificial intelligence workloads, as demand for specialized AI chips continues to grow globally. This capital deployment signals Intel's determination to compete in the high-stakes AI chip market, where rivals are also aggressively expanding capacity and capability.
